Certified Occupational Therapy Assistant (COTA) - Part-Time (Bethesda Clinic, Afternoon/Evening Hours)

Make a Lasting Impact in a Supportive Clinic Environment

National Therapy Center seeks an experienced part-time Certified Occupational Therapy Assistant (COTA) to join our Bethesda clinic team. This role is ideal for professionals passionate about delivering high-quality pediatric care and who are comfortable working independently under remote supervision.

This clinic-based position offers a consistent afternoon/evening schedule from 2:30 PM to 6:30 PM, up to four days per week, and is perfect for candidates seeking flexible part-time hours.

Your Role:

  • Deliver individualized, evidence-based occupational therapy to pediatric clients.

  • Implement OT-developed treatment plans with remote oversight.

  • Accurately document sessions and progress promptly.

  • Collaborate with families and clinic staff to align therapy goals.

  • Maintain a minimum of 10 and no more than 24 clinic-based billable hours per week within your assigned 2:30-6:30 PM schedule.

Qualifications:

  • Associate's degree in Occupational Therapy from an accredited program.

  • Active COTA license in Maryland.

  • 3-5 years of pediatric experience required.

  • Excellent communication, documentation, and collaboration skills.

  • Must be comfortable working independently under remote supervision.
